Bathroom Expansion in Lancaster, PA
Bathroom expansion services involve modifying and enlarging existing bathroom spaces to improve functionality, comfort, and aesthetic appeal. These projects can include adding extra square footage to accommodate larger fixtures, creating additional storage areas, or reconfiguring layouts to better suit the needs of the household. Common requests include expanding a small bathroom to include a walk-in shower or bathtub, converting underused spaces into full bathrooms, or combining separate toilet and vanity areas into a more open, cohesive layout. Homeowners should consider factors such as existing plumbing and electrical systems, space availability, and overall design goals before requesting an expansion project.
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including any structural modifications, permits that may be required, and the impact on existing utilities. Clarifying the desired features, such as new fixtures, storage solutions, or accessibility improvements, can help ensure the project aligns with expectations. It’s also important to assess the available space, budget considerations, and potential renovation timelines to facilitate a smooth and efficient expansion process.

Bathroom Expansion Questions
What types of bathroom expansion projects are common? Common projects include adding extra space for a larger shower, expanding a bathroom to include a separate tub and shower, or enlarging the overall bathroom area for improved comfort.
What should property owners consider before expanding a bathroom? It’s important to evaluate existing plumbing and electrical systems, available space, and how the new layout will impact the overall home design.
Are there design options to maximize small bathroom expansions? Yes, creative layout choices, such as wall-mounted fixtures and space-saving storage, can make small expansions feel more spacious and functional.
What are common reasons for choosing a bathroom expansion? Reasons include increasing home value, improving accessibility, or creating a more comfortable and functional bathroom space.
